Digital Metal announces the production automation concept for binder jet metal 3D printing.

The cutting-edge Digital Metal binder jetting technology has already produced 300,000 parts. The commercial machine DM P2500 mass-produces 40,000 parts per year. In 2018, it was decided to deliver to companies in the automotive and aerospace sectors. Additionally, a concept for the automation of 3D printers was announced, taking a step into the future. - Most of the process is handled by robots - Robots transport the build box to the printer - Robots carry the box to the powder removal device - Powder is removed using CNC control - Unused metal powder is recycled without degradation - Pick-and-place robots place parts onto plates - Robots transport the plates to the debinding and sintering furnace Ralph Karlström of Digital Metal states, "Other AM technologies propose a low level of automation, but we will change that. Automation improves productivity and reduces costs. Powder can be automatically recycled without waste and applied to mass production. We are confident in the potential of our technology. It is not only fast and cost-effective but also capable of complex and detailed designs with a wide range of materials."
